Surgery Final Exams At BMC

Final surgery practical exams today were conducted for the medicine students at the Benghazi Medical Centre. The students were examined across 8 various stations, and each student is evaluated theoretically and practically in order to pass. We wish the best of luck to all students.

Fourth Year Medical Students Take An OSCE Exam

A 78 medical students in the 4th year this morning for the 2nd consecutive day undertook an Objective Structured Clinical Examination, for the clinical skills module. The OSCE exam consists of multiple stations covering various cases, under the supervision of faculty members and professors.
